There was a little mistake in the initial design of flask-tryton.
It should be fixed with
https://code.google.com/p/flask-tryton/source/detail?r=34c8b01ac62f6ad2431c90088f32a87f8e6df7af
Otherwise, you should not use current_app but import the instance of
Flask from the right module.
